Constipation in Canines: The Facts
Canine constipation is a common issue affecting millions of dogs worldwide. It's estimated that up to 50% of dogs experience some form of constipation at least once in their lifetime. This can range from mild discomfort to life-threatening situations, making it essential to understand the underlying causes and remedies.
Constipation in dogs can be caused by a variety of factors, including diet, dehydration, lack of exercise, and underlying medical conditions. As a responsible pet owner, it's crucial to recognize the signs of constipation, such as straining during bowel movements, hard or dry stools, and decreased appetite.

- This first and most obvious is to check and adjust the dog's diet to include more fiber-rich ingredients and ensure proper hydration. Water is essential for the digestive system, and your dog needs access to it at all times.
- A gentle massage can help stimulate bowel movements and relieve any discomfort. Just be sure to massage your dog gently and not to apply too much pressure.
- Add a small amount of oil to your dog's food to lubricate their digestive system. You can try coconut oil, olive oil, or canola oil.
- This may sound strange but some dog owners swear by adding a small amount of pumpkin to their dog's food. Pumpkin is high in fiber and helps move food through the digestive system more smoothly.
- Finally, consult with your veterinarian about the use of a natural laxative or stool softener if all else fails.
